Understanding the Seminole County Student Insurance Enrollment Form
The Seminole County Student Insurance Enrollment Form is a vital document for parents or guardians aiming to enroll their children in a school-approved insurance plan in Seminole County, Florida. This form specifically facilitates access to essential insurance coverage, providing options such as basic accident insurance and an optional in-hospital sickness benefit. Coverage begins on the first day of school and lasts until the end of the term, ensuring students have protection while participating in school activities.
By completing this form, families secure their child's eligibility for crucial financial support in the event of an accident.

Who is eligible to use the Seminole County Student Insurance Enrollment Form?
Parents or guardians of students enrolled in Seminole County schools are eligible to use this form to enroll their children in a state-approved insurance plan.
What is the deadline for submitting the Student Insurance Enrollment Form?
It's crucial to submit the form before the start of the school term to ensure coverage takes effect on the first day of school.
How can I submit the completed Student Insurance Enrollment Form?
You can submit the form through pdfFiller by following the prompts for online submission, or by downloading it and submitting it directly to School Insurance of Florida.
What information do I need to complete the form?
You'll need your child's name, address, selected insurance coverage options, and payment details to complete the Seminole County Student Insurance Enrollment Form.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ure that all required fields are filled accurately and avoid missing the selection of coverage options to prevent delays in enrollment.
What are the processing times for the insurance coverage?
Coverage is effective from the first day of school upon successful submission of the form and payment. Processing times may vary, so submit promptly.
Can I make changes to the form after submission?
Once submitted, any changes will generally require a new form submission. Contact School Insurance of Florida for specific procedures regarding amendments.
